The black stallion cantered back along the beach. She feeling the freedom of his moments, picked up a handful of sand and let it run through her young, delicate fingers. "More stars in the universe than grains of sand on every beach in this world," she whispered. "Each grain different from the rest." Laine stared, absorbed by the thousand grains seeping through her knuckles, to join the rest of the sand at her feet.

The horse demanded attention now, stamping his foot at hers. Still in her trance she pulled her self up by his mane on to the strong solid black back. They rode as one in the rhythm of the wind.

At that moment all the vibrations resonated with an ancient part in her brain. 'Buzzzzzz...' her brain started hitting the sides of her skull rapidly, vibrating so fast that she was out of her own control. She grasped at the horse, no longer there. Her tight scared eyes opened to reveal space. She was in the middle of space surrounded by the light of the stars. Sudden peace fell upon her mind.

Laine realized she would never again be a girl on a beach. Her light reaching out in to the darkness, toward the rest of the chosen souls.
